How Hawthorne Criminal Defense Matters Route Through Court
Disorderly persons and petty disorderly persons offenses charged in Hawthorne stay in Hawthorne Boro Municipal Court. Indictable charges (third degree and above) route to Passaic County Superior Court — Criminal Division at Passaic County Court House, 77 Hamilton Street, Paterson, NJ 07505. Pretrial Intervention (PTI) applications go through the Passaic County Prosecutor’s Office. Conditional Discharge for first-offense drug possession remains available in municipal court.
